From John Adams to Jedidiah Morse

26 May 1816

Dear Sir Quincy May 26th 1816

I have received your Favour of the Second of this Month, and the Letters I lent you of Governor Mackean: but not the Pamphlet I lent you at the Sametime, So improperly entitled by British Editors, “History of the disputes with America.”

This Pamphlet, the only one I know, at present, I pray you to return as Soon as possible; because I have immediate Occasion for it.

I am, Sir, very respectfully your old Friend

John Adams

MHi: Hoar Autograph Collection.
